Get Pre-Approved for a Home Mortgage
Obtaining pre-approved for a home loan is an essential action in your home-buying trip since it offers you a clear understanding of your spending plan and strengthens your position when making a deal. This process involves a lender reviewing your economic situation, including your credit rating, revenue, and financial debts (OC Home Buyers). When approved, you'll get a pre-approval letter suggesting just how much you can borrow, which shows sellers you're a major customer
Before you begin looking for homes, gather essential files like pay stubs, income tax return, and financial institution statements to quicken the pre-approval process. Bear in mind that pre-approval isn't the like pre-qualification-- it's a more detailed evaluation that carries even more weight.
Additionally, be mindful that your economic situation ought to remain steady throughout this time; any type of significant modifications might affect your approval. With a pre-approval letter in hand, you'll really feel more positive and encouraged as you browse the competitive housing market.

Conduct Thorough Home Inspections

While you might be eager to resolve right into your new home, conducting thorough home inspections is essential to assure you're Discover More Here making a sound investment. Beginning by employing a qualified assessor who recognizes what to try to find. They'll inspect crucial locations like the roofing, foundation, pipes, and electrical systems, aiding you discover potential problems that could cost you later on.
Don't wait to go to the inspection on your own. This gives you an opportunity to ask questions and obtain insight right into the building's condition. Focus on minor information as well, as they can indicate larger troubles.
If the evaluation discloses considerable concerns, use this details to negotiate repair services or price modifications. Remember, a complete inspection isn't nearly finding troubles; it's also regarding recognizing the home's total condition. With the ideal strategy, you'll feel great in your acquisition choice, ensuring your new home fulfills your assumptions and needs.

Exactly how Do I Improve My Credit Report Before Buying a Home?
To boost your credit rating before getting a home, pay down existing financial debts, pay in a timely manner, avoid brand-new credit history inquiries, and regularly inspect your credit scores record for errors you can contest.
What Added Expenses Should I Anticipate When Purchasing a Home?
When acquiring a home, you'll experience added costs like closing costs, home tax obligations, insurance coverage, and upkeep expenses. Don't neglect to spending plan for moving expenses and possible remodellings to assure a smooth changeover into your brand-new home.
Can I Back Out of an Offer After Making a Deal?
Yes, you can back out after making an offer, but it typically depends upon the contract terms. If you're within the assessment or backup duration, you could stay clear of fines, so check your agreement thoroughly.
Exactly how Long Does the Home Purchasing Refine Normally Take?
The home acquiring procedure generally takes around 30 to 60 days after your deal is approved. Variables like funding, examinations, and paperwork can impact the timeline, so remain aggressive and maintain interaction open with your representative.
